A few weeks ago, we discovered a new address for Parisian carnivores: Les tantes Jeanne.
Just off the Butte Montmartre, this meat specialist opened a little over a year ago and offers a mouth-watering menu for the discerning carnivore.
Carpaccio of scallops with lemon caviar, grenobloise-style veal brain, marrow bone rotis and half-cooked duck foie gras, so many dishes worth a detour.
Beef is at the heart of the debate, from the absolutely succulent Kobe-style Wagyu beef to the famous black angus. For the less carnivorous, the fish menu is also very good.
